The Global Information Security (GIS) team is a critical component of our Technology division. They are focused on delivering a safe and secure environment for the operation of our markets.

    Have you heard of the CIA Triad? Are you curious how security is built into the software product lifecycle? CME Group is looking for a motivated intern with a deep interest in application security to join in the GIS Application Architecture team.

    CME Group's GIS Application Architecture team works closely with the development, application architecture and other teams across the organization to integrate security into every phase of the software development life cycle (SDLC) using the industry best SSDLC practices, from design through deployment. The team also builds DevSecOps pipeline to automate security tasks, such as vulnerability scans, and shift the security ownership into the hands of the developers. Additionally the team provides security guidance to software development teams.

    GIS interns will gain an unparalleled experience in financial technology. Interns will help protect and ensure the confidentiality, integrity and availability of our global assets.
